Oklahoma State Ranked 17th in Preseason AP Poll
August 12, 2024 | Cowboy Football
STILLWATER – Oklahoma State is 17th in the preseason Associated Press poll that was announced Monday.
It marks the fifth time since 2016 that the Cowboys have started a season ranked in the AP Top 25 and continues a run of OSU being ranked in every season since 2008.
The Cowboys are the second-highest ranked Big 12 team in the opening poll of 2024 and are joined by conference members Utah (No. 12 ), Kansas State (No. 18), Arizona (No. 21) and Kansas (No. 22). Iowa State, West Virginia and Colorado also received votes in the poll.
Oklahoma State opens the season against South Dakota State at Boone Pickens Stadium on Saturday, August 31, at 1 p.m. Season tickets are sold out for a second consecutive season and limited single game tickets remain for available for purchase through okstate.com/tickets or 877-ALL-4-OSU.
